Website Content: Answering the Questions AI Tools Are Looking For
AI tools prioritize content that directly answers questions over content that describes services. That’s a meaningful distinction. A service page that says “we provide comprehensive marketing solutions for small businesses” doesn’t answer much. A service page that addresses what a small business owner in Spokane actually gets from working with a marketing agency does.
How AI Overviews work and what they mean for your visibility explains the selection process. The practical result is that WDW writes and structures content to answer real customer questions directly. That includes clear service pages, FAQ sections built around actual searches, and copy that uses the specific language your customers are typing.

Credibility Signals: Earning Trust Before Getting Cited
Before an AI tool cites your business, it needs to trust it. That trust is built across multiple signals: consistent business information across directories, a strong review profile, mentions from credible outside sources, and content that demonstrates genuine expertise in your field.
This maps closely to Google’s E-E-A-T framework, which influences both traditional rankings and AI Overview selection. Google Business Profile and Local Signals: Still the Foundation
For local businesses, the Google Business Profile remains one of the most powerful tools available. It feeds directly into Google’s AI Overviews for local queries and tells AI tools what your business does, where it operates, and how customers experience it.

On-Page Structure: Making Your Content Easy for AI to Read
AI tools don’t read your website the way a human does. They’re parsing structure, extracting meaning, and deciding whether your content answers what someone searched for. That process favors pages with clear headings, short paragraphs, direct sentences, and specific answers.
Schema markup adds a layer of structured data that tells AI tools and search engines explicitly what your content means: who you are, what you offer, where you’re located, and what customers say about you. It’s not visible to your visitors, but it’s one of the clearest signals your site can send. How long does it take to see results from AI search visibility work?
For most Spokane small businesses, meaningful progress becomes visible within three to six months of consistent work. Google Business Profile and on-page improvements tend to show results faster than credibility and citation building, which takes longer but has more durable impact.
